What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.453(b)(2)(v): A safety harness with lanyard attached to the boom or basket was not worn by employees working from an aerial lift:   At the front of the building:  Employees working from an aerial lift were not tied-off to anchors provided in the platform, exposing employees to fall hazards.

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(1): Each employee on a walking/working surface with an unprotected side or edge which was 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above a lower level was not protected from falling by the use of guardrail systems,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ems.   At the front of the building:  Employees working from the 2nd floor overhang were not protected from falling to the lower level.
